QUOTE (Cs91 @ Jan 27, 2010 - 8:32 AM) *
What have you done with the RCA's on the alpine player? Did you ground them that way to get rid of noise?


The rcas on the Alpine were giving me alternator whine because my processor is made for 100 ohm and up resistance and the deck is nowhere near that quality. Most decks are made with bad grounding potential when you run all 6 channels at once. It nearly fixed the whine when i grounded them out. Unless you have a high dollar system or a bad ground loop in the first place, this deck will work great.
